Prajna Zen Forest.
Xuanmiao Hall.
Dozens of people in the innate realm of Prajna Zen Temple, as well as masters from various forces are all there.
A long desk lay across the middle of the hall. Master Gu Ming, whose injuries had not yet healed and whose face was pale, held a rosary in his hand. Opposite him sat the envoys of the Great Qin Dynasty, the Imperial Censor Qin Mu, and the Grand Secretary Sun Botang.
"Ahem," Sun Botang coughed lightly, then said, "Master Gu Ming, the first clause of the contract is that Prajna Zen Temple apologizes for enslaving the people of Daqin and pays 800,000 taels of gold as compensation. Is this okay?"
His palms clenched lightly, and the corners of his eyes twitched slightly.
Qin Mu beside him also held his breath slightly.
There are so many masters from Liangyuan Domain here. If they launch an attack, he and Sun Botang, who are weak and helpless, will not be able to escape.
At this moment, feeling the solemn atmosphere in the hall, Qin Mu had reason to suspect that Qingyang Bo wanted to use the monks in Liangyuan Territory to harm him and Sun Botang.
His suicide note has already been written.
Across from him, Master Gu Ming stopped holding the rosary in his hand, his face looking solemn.
He stood up slowly, his body straight and his breath as deep as the ocean.
Even injured, he is still a master.
Sun Botang swallowed his saliva.
Qin Mu clenched his fists in his sleeves.
"Gu Ming, on behalf of the Prajna Zen Temple, apologize to Daqin and the enslaved miners."
Master Gu Ming put his hands together and bent his waist towards the long table.
Behind him, all the masters of the Prajna Zen Temple from all directions in Liangyuan Territory bowed.
Sun Botang trembled all over and slowly stood up.
Qin Mu beside him also stood up.
"Lord Qingyang once said that all human beings are born equal, whether it is innate or acquired, masters or ordinary people, all should be treated equally." Master Gu Ming's rosary in his hands moved slightly.
"This is the difference between humans and animals."
"Gu Ming has realized his mistake, and I, Prajna Zen Lin, have also realized my mistake."
"All of this is due to that evil Zenxin's greed and selfishness."
Master Gu Ming's words were filled with sincerity and indignation.
His face was full of justice and he bowed again.
"Gu Ming will practice asceticism and eat vegetarian food every day to atone for his sins."
After saying that, he sat down.
"Eight hundred thousand taels of gold is too little compensation. One million is better."
million?
million!
Sun Botang and Qin Mu looked at each other and almost bit their tongues.
"Then, let's discuss the second point?"
Qin Mu looked up.
Master Gu Ming nodded.
Second, because the efficiency of Prajna Zen Temple in mining the Yutan Mountain gold mine was low, Daqin Wuchang helped them mine the gold.
Of the mined gold, 20% was given to the Prajna Zen Temple, and the remaining 80% was given to Daqin.
Article 3. In order to help the people of Liangyuan Territory, Daqin will arrange 100,000 troops to be stationed in 20 areas in Liangyuan Territory. The expenses of these 100,000 troops will be borne by all parties in Liangyuan Territory.
The fourth and fifth articles include setting up a trading company in front of Yuzhao Temple to trade with Daqin.
The monk soldiers in Liangyuan Territory can be hired by Daqin, and the people who go to Daqin to make a living cannot be stopped by any party in Liangyuan Territory, etc.
In the eyes of Sun Botang and Qin Mu, each of these was intended to cut off the roots of Liangyuan Territory, and all parties in Liangyuan Territory would never agree to it.
But right in front of them, Master Gu Ming and all the parties from Liangyuan Territory agreed so readily.
Until all the contracts were signed, both of them were like sleepwalking.
"Is that it, done?" After everyone left, Qin Mu looked at Sun Botang.
Sun Botang nodded and said blankly, "About that's it."

The Great Qin Imperial City.
Zongren Mansion.
Zhao Yu looked at the plates of gold and jade beads before him, rubbing his hands together, his eyes bright. "Well, Shopkeeper Zhao, I can't help much. I'm so sorry..."
She said this, but her hands were honest and she had already taken both the gold and jade beads.
Although it's only a few dozen taels of gold and jade beads, who would complain about it being too little?
Aren’t most of them unexpected gains?
"If it weren't for Princess Yuruo's recommendation, we wouldn't have known to ask Captain Zhang of the Luyang Prefecture Wuwei Yamen for help."
"Without Captain Zhang's help, my caravan would never have returned."
"This is a thank you gift, I should have it."
The eldest prince, standing in front of Zhao Yu, waved his hand and walked forward, saying, "Of course, it is also thanks to your planning, Princess Yuruo, that the caravan was able to travel through the wilderness and forests."
These words made Zhao Yu look a little proud.
Walking forward, the eldest prince paused and turned to look at Zhao Yu.
"Princess Yuruo, I have a problem now."
"Please help me consider this, my lord."
Zhao Yu hurriedly said, "Manager Zhao, you are a big businessman. How can I be so competent as to consult you?"
This made the eldest prince chuckle and shake his head.
"Princess Yuruo is being modest."
"Your Yuyuan Trading Company can sell a thousand taels of gold for just one painting. Isn't this a big business?"
Zhao Yu was stunned and whispered, "My company sells paintings at different prices, and I won't tell anyone else..."
She looked up at the eldest prince with a smile on her face: "It seems that my company's most important customer is Shopkeeper Zhao."
The eldest prince did not deny it, but simply said: "My caravan has returned, and the leader of the guards should be rewarded."
"Of course. After such an experience, anyone who can come back alive will be rewarded handsomely." Zhao Yu nodded.
"The problem is, in order to control the caravan, the guard commander killed some of the men and guards who refused to obey orders." The eldest prince looked troubled. "Now many people in the clan are holding on to this matter and want to severely punish the guard commander."
"Severe punishment?" Zhao Yu frowned. "If you do, the morale of your caravan will be broken. If you don't reward those who risked their lives, who will be willing to work for your company in the future?"
The eldest prince sighed softly, "Ah, who says it's not true? That's why I asked you to help me think about it and see if there's any solution."
Zhao Yu pondered for a moment, then nodded and said, "It's not that there is no way."
"After all, he killed someone, so he is guilty. I can punish him, but he deserves to be rewarded for his merits."
“Only by clearly defining rewards and punishments can there be rules.”
In the distance, many women in the courtyard were walking quickly.
"Yuruo, the imperial concubine is here."
"Hurry, Concubine Qi is coming to test us, get ready quickly."
The women walked into the courtyard nervously.
"Well," Zhao Yu looked ahead and whispered, "I'll come up with a few ideas. Shopkeeper Zhao, do you think they're feasible? I'm just talking nonsense anyway."
"First, let the guard leader use the excuse of recuperating or going into seclusion, or arrange for him to study elsewhere."
"Anyway, we can suppress him for a while to prevent people from holding him accountable. At this time, we can publicize how he will be punished and calm public opinion."
"Also, it's not appropriate to publicly publicize his achievements, but the company can give him some practical rewards, such as precious elixirs, cultivation techniques, or something tangible."
As he turned and walked towards the courtyard, Zhao Yu continued, "Of course, if the company really values someone's abilities and achievements, they can arrange a marriage and keep him firmly in their control."
"Your family must have a daughter suitable for marriage, right?"
After Zhao Yu finished speaking, he quickly ran into the courtyard.
The eldest prince turned his head to look at Concubine Qi who was being walked towards the courtyard surrounded by maids, then looked at Zhao Yu who ran into the courtyard, and shook his head slightly.
"Marriage?"
"This girl is clearly betraying her own people..."
Zhao Yu is so smart and he is in the imperial city. Even if he didn't know before that Zhang Yuan led the army to start a national war, how could he not know it now?
Which of the rewards and punishments she proposed would not benefit the leader of the guards?
"Your Majesty, Your Majesty has summoned me."
"The documents impeaching Lord Qingyang at the Imperial Censorate are almost piled three feet high."
A servant walked quickly to the eldest prince and reported in a low voice.
"Your Highness, the palace is as noisy as a vegetable market right now."
The eldest prince nodded and got on the carriage.
"Go to Qianyang Palace."
